優(yōu)化代碼的CSS和JavaScript工具有哪些

本文小編為大家詳細(xì)介紹“優(yōu)化代碼的CSS和JavaScript工具有哪些”,內(nèi)容詳細(xì),步驟清晰,細(xì)節(jié)處理妥當(dāng),希望這篇“優(yōu)化代碼的CSS和JavaScript工具有哪些”文章能幫助大家解決疑惑,下面跟著小編的思路慢慢深入,一起來學(xué)習(xí)新知識吧。

成都創(chuàng)新互聯(lián)公司專注于企業(yè)網(wǎng)絡(luò)營銷推廣、網(wǎng)站重做改版、孝義網(wǎng)站定制設(shè)計、自適應(yīng)品牌網(wǎng)站建設(shè)、H5網(wǎng)站設(shè)計、商城開發(fā)、集團(tuán)公司官網(wǎng)建設(shè)、外貿(mào)營銷網(wǎng)站建設(shè)、高端網(wǎng)站制作、響應(yīng)式網(wǎng)頁設(shè)計等建站業(yè)務(wù),價格優(yōu)惠性價比高,為孝義等各大城市提供網(wǎng)站開發(fā)制作服務(wù)。

1.CSSLint

誠然CSSLint會“傷害你的感情”,但作為交換它會“讓你的代碼改進(jìn)很多” 。CSSLint目前領(lǐng)導(dǎo)了CSS linting的市場。它用JavaScript編寫,不但是開源的,而且自帶大量的配置選項(xiàng)。

2.SublimeLinter CSSLint

CSSLint是一次如此高效的CSS  linting工具,以致于很難找到一個競爭對手可以與之媲美。也許這就是為什么 SublimeLinter linting框架會把它的CSS  linting插件構(gòu)建在CSSLint上面的原因。SublimeLinter是一個  SublimeText插件,給用戶提供了lint代碼(CSS,PHP,Python,Java,Ruby等)的手段。

3.StyleLint

StyleLint可以幫助開發(fā)人員避免CSS、SCSS中或任何其他PostCSS可以解析的語法錯誤。StyleLint測試了超過一百條規(guī)則,你可以選擇你想切換的那些規(guī)則(見此舉例配置)。

4.W3C CSS Validator

盡管W3C的CSS Validator通常不被認(rèn)為是一種linting工具,但它為開發(fā)人員提供了一個用W3C官方標(biāo)準(zhǔn)檢查CSS代碼的很好機(jī)會。W3C建立它自己的驗(yàn)證程序,旨在提供一個類似于Lint程序檢查器針對C語言的工具。

5.Dirty Markup

Dirty Markup可以清理,格式化以及驗(yàn)證你的HTML、CSS和JavaScript代碼。如果你喜歡簡單直接的設(shè)計,并希望一個快捷的解決方案,那么選它就對了。當(dāng)你在編輯器中編寫或修改代碼的時候,Dirty Markup可以實(shí)時拋出錯誤消息和通知。

6.JSLint

JSLint最初由Douglas Crockford發(fā)布于2002年,從那時起就有了蓬勃的生命力,因此你可以安全地認(rèn)定它是一個既穩(wěn)定又可靠的JavaScript linting工具。

7.JSHint

JSHint是一個社區(qū)驅(qū)動項(xiàng)目,始于竭力創(chuàng)造一個更可配置,不那么固執(zhí)的JSLint版本。JSHint允許開發(fā)人員配置任何它的linting選項(xiàng),然后把自定義的配置放到一個單獨(dú)的文件中,這使得該工具很容易重復(fù)使用,因此非常適合大型項(xiàng)目。

8.ESLint

ESLint是JavaScript linting宏圖中最近的一件大事。之所以受歡迎是因?yàn)楦叨褥`活的特性。你不僅可以自定義大量尖端的linting規(guī)則,將之與所有主要的代碼編輯器集成,還可以很容易地通過添加不同的插件擴(kuò)展其功能。

9.JSCS

JSCS,或JavaScript  Code  Style,是針對JavaScript的一個可插拔的代碼風(fēng)格linter,用來檢查代碼格式規(guī)則。JSCS的目標(biāo)是提供一個用編程方式實(shí)施遵從于某一   編碼風(fēng)格向?qū)У氖侄?。雖然JSCS不檢查bug和錯誤,但它仍然為許多高科技行業(yè)的參與者,如谷歌、AirBnB和AngularJS所用,因?yàn)樗梢詭? 助開發(fā)人員保持一個高度可讀又一致的代碼庫。

10.StandardJS

StandardJS,或JavaScript Standard Style是一種代碼風(fēng)格linter,有點(diǎn)像JSCS,但區(qū)別是更為簡單和直接。如果你不想花時間在配置上,只想要一個能開箱即用的高效工具的話,那么StandardJS是一個超棒的選擇。

讀到這里,這篇“優(yōu)化代碼的CSS和JavaScript工具有哪些”文章已經(jīng)介紹完畢,想要掌握這篇文章的知識點(diǎn)還需要大家自己動手實(shí)踐使用過才能領(lǐng)會,如果想了解更多相關(guān)內(nèi)容的文章,歡迎關(guān)注創(chuàng)新互聯(lián)行業(yè)資訊頻道。

文章名稱:優(yōu)化代碼的CSS和JavaScript工具有哪些
網(wǎng)址分享:http://muchs.cn/article2/jsopic.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供品牌網(wǎng)站設(shè)計、網(wǎng)站設(shè)計公司企業(yè)建站、全網(wǎng)營銷推廣、網(wǎng)站建設(shè)虛擬主機(jī)

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

手機(jī)網(wǎng)站建設(shè)